Anomalies in the surface impedance penetration depth in ferromagnetic superconductors
1985
Abstract We have investigated the surface impedance penetration depth, Λ, of ErRh 4 B 4 and Er 0.5 Ho 0.5 Rh 4 B 4 both experimentally and theoretically. For ErRh 4 B 4 , owing to the critical spin fluctuations just above T s ( > T c 2 ), the critical temperature at which surface ferromagnetism appears, Λ −1 decreases smoothly as T decreases toward T s . For Er 0.5 Ho 0.5 Rh 4 B 4 , the decrease in Λ −1 owing to spin fluctuations for T ⪆ T c2 is very small, and Λ −1 decreases abruptly at T c2 . Theoretical values of Λ −1 are in good agreement with the data.
